×

Soul Brothers

Dec 7, 2024  ·  Germiston Theatre, Germiston Germiston Theatre, Germiston

Soul Brothers
Dec 7
Soul Brothers
Past Concert

Concert Info

Videos

Venue Info

You May Also Like

Report a problem